I have a very large DVD collection and I am trying to digitize it by ripping the discs to ISO. The problem is my dvd drives aren't getting anywhere near their rated speed. One of them seems to be firmware limited to about 3x, and the other one hovers around 8x.

I want to know if there is anything I can do about this, or what drives would make good replacements. Newegg has an 18x DVD-ROM drive for $20 (http://www.newegg.com/Product/Product.aspx?Item=N82E16827106276), but even though it says that I don't know what the actual read speed would be.

You didn't mention your drive make/model.......

As long as you have checked the obviously (that you're drive is in DMA mode and not PIO) I wouldn't worry too much about it. Some disks will rip quicker than others, I love my drive, rips great but on some disks the process can be quite tedious. The method of ripping has an effect too, as an example: If I were to rip a DVD that is a different region to my system in DVD Decrypter for example and it has to switch to brute-force then ripping will be slow (starts at about x2 and slowly rises). Other disks much quicker.

You could always have a look around for any custom firmwares, see what's available, may improve things for you.

There is a "feature" called RipLock which is integrated into many drive's firmware which deliberately limits ripping speed.

But there also is a software called "MediaCodeSpeedEdit" which can disable RipLock. Maybe you are affected by this, you should google if MediaCodeSpeedEdit is available for your specific drive.

Speed ramps up as the disc proceeds. It doesn't get to 12x-18x until the very end anyway. Most of a disc is read at 4x-6x. It's the same for burning.

Nothing can burn at an average of 18x or even 16x.

The average burn/read speed is around 4x-8x range, and it doesn't get to 16x until the last few seconds of a completely-full 4.38GB DVD. If it does up to 18x, it would only hit that at the very tail-end of the burn. There is almost NO DIFFERENCE between 12x, 16x, 18x, 20x, etc --- aside from potential data loss from a bad burn at those high speeds.

A 12x burn is the most you should do on 16x media, for the best results.

Reading that fast can be an issue, too -- causing the drive to work harder than necessary to re-read imperfect/bad areas of the disc. A slower read in the 8x-12x range is better, and can actually go faster than a 16x read that has drive thrashing from re-read attempts.

The optimal burn speed for 8x-16x media is not half the rating -- it's one rating under.
For 16x media, you burn 12x (or 8x if the burner can't do 12x).
For 8x media, look at 6x (or 4x if the burner can't do 6x).
If you have 4x media, you don't want to burn it 2x. Same for 2x media.
If you burn media too slow, it can be just as bad as burning it over the rating (i.e., 8x media at 12x).
Media are rated by an "x" speed for a reason.

Anybody that doesn't want to believe me needs to look up PCAV and Z-CLV burning.
The inner part of a disc reads/writes slower than the outer edge. It's a fact of physics.

Just burn at 4x or less and you'll have CLV thus the average speed is the actual speed...

The burners that use more than 4x will have to use CAV, PCAV, ZLV, PZLV and their combination, with the highest speed attained only at the edge, which explains why the PI/PO errors have a peak also in that region.

My 'math' for Average Read/Write rate is simply: amount of data / time taken.

Right or wrong, that's what it is.

Burning at 24x would (according to my math) get you an average of ~15x. At 16x, not a chance.
